Okay, you’ve got your list. Now it’s time to find suppliers. Start with a quick Google search for “lean tube supplier” or “aluminum lean pipe wholesale,” but don’t stop at the first page. Check B2B platforms too – just be wary of generic listings. Once you have 5-7 candidates, put them through this vetting process:
Any serious supplier should have basic certifications. For example, if you’re in electronics manufacturing, ESD workbenches need to meet ANSI/ESD S20.20 standards. For food or medical industries, look for ISO 9001 or FDA compliance. A supplier who can’t provide these docs? Move on – they’re probably cutting corners on materials or testing.
A “cheap” supplier isn’t helpful if they can’t deliver your order on time. Ask questions like: “What’s your typical lead time for 500 aluminum lean pipes?” or “Do you have backup production lines if there’s a delay?” If they hesitate or give vague answers (“maybe 2-4 weeks?”), that’s a red flag. Reliable suppliers know their capacity down to the day.
A supplier might claim they work with “top manufacturers,” but can they name names? Ask for references or case studies. Even better, check review sites or industry forums. If other factories in your sector rave about a supplier’s quick shipping or responsive customer service, that’s a good sign. If you see complaints like “tubes arrived bent” or “no one answered my emails after payment,” run.
| Supplier Type | Pros | Cons | Best For |
|---|---|---|---|
| Large Wholesale Distributors | Wide product range, bulk discounts, fast shipping | Higher minimum orders, less customization | Big factories with standard needs |
| Specialized Lean Solution Providers | Expertise in lean tools, custom designs, technical support | Slightly higher prices than generic distributors | Factories optimizing workflows (e.g., adding flow racks) |
| Local Manufacturers | Lower shipping costs, quick turnaround, easy to visit factory | Limited product range, smaller production capacity | Small businesses or urgent, small orders |
So you’ve got 3-4 suppliers who pass the vetting test. Now they send over quotes – and they all look different. One is $500 cheaper, another includes “free shipping,” and the third mentions “lifetime warranty.” How do you compare apples to apples?
First, break down the total cost. The $500 cheaper quote might exclude taxes, shipping, or a required accessory (like end caps for the tubes). The “free shipping” might only apply if you order 2x more than you need. Ask each supplier to send a detailed breakdown: unit price, quantity, taxes, shipping, and any extra fees (customization, rush orders, returns). Then plug those numbers into a spreadsheet – you’ll often find the “cheapest” quote isn’t actually the best deal.
Next, ask about hidden costs. For example: What if a tube arrives damaged? Does the supplier cover return shipping? Do they charge for technical support if you need help assembling the workbench? A supplier with slightly higher upfront costs but better coverage for these scenarios can save you money in the long run.
Finally, don’t be afraid to negotiate. If Supplier A has a lower price but Supplier B has better warranty, tell Supplier A: “I like your price, but Supplier B offers a 2-year warranty. Can you match that or adjust the price?” Many suppliers will bend on terms to win your business – especially if you mention you’re considering a long-term partnership.

If you’re still using traditional steel lean pipe, listen up: aluminum lean pipe is a game-changer. It’s 30% lighter than steel, so your team can assemble and reconfigure workbenches or racks without straining their backs. It’s also naturally rust-resistant, which means it lasts longer in humid or messy environments (looking at you, food processing plants). And because it’s easier to cut and drill, you can customize lengths on-site without fancy tools.

If your production line uses a lot of small parts (think screws, connectors, or circuit boards), flow racks (or flow racks) are a must. These racks use gravity to slide materials from the back to the front, so workers don’t have to bend, reach, or search for parts. The result? Faster assembly times and fewer mistakes.
When shopping for flow racks, pay attention to the roller tracks – plastic vs. steel, wheel size (1 inch vs. 0.5 inch), and load capacity. A cheap flow rack with flimsy plastic rollers might save you $100 upfront, but if the wheels break and parts get stuck, you’ll lose hours of productivity fixing it. Look for suppliers who use high-quality roller track placon mounts and aluminum guide rails – they’ll last longer.
Even with the best intentions, it’s easy to fall for supplier tricks. Here’s what to watch out for:
If a supplier’s price is 50% lower than everyone else, ask why. Are they using thinner wall tubes (1.0mm instead of 1.5mm)? Selling leftover stock with scratches or dents? Using low-grade aluminum that bends easily? A quick question: “Can you send me a sample of the aluminum lean pipe?” will tell you everything. If the sample feels flimsy or the finish is uneven, walk away.
You order 100 tubes, and 10 arrive bent. The supplier says, “Sorry, all sales are final.” Now you’re stuck with useless parts and have to reorder – costing you time and money. Always ask: “What’s your return policy for damaged goods?” and “Do you offer technical support if we have questions during assembly?” A reliable supplier will have clear answers.
“Free shipping!” sounds great – until you check out and see a “handling fee” or “fuel surcharge” that adds 20% to your order. Always ask for a final all-inclusive quote before paying. If a supplier hesitates to provide one, that’s a red flag they’re hiding something.
